Sha256: f24af4cc412cfe3f54a6b210dbae6b836e5b784f4fde4f11a37e86122db2b130
Contents?: true
Size: 379 Bytes
Versions: 15
Compression:
Stored size: 379 Bytes
Contents
module Approvals module Writers class ArrayWriter < TextWriter def format(data) filter(data).map.with_index do |value, i| "[#{i.inspect}] #{value.inspect}\n" end.join end def filter data filter = ::Approvals::Filter.new(Approvals.configuration.excluded_json_keys) filter.apply(data) end end end end
Version data entries
15 entries across 15 versions & 2 rubygems